Show Notes

Doug interviews Will Hatton, the entrepreneur behind the successful travel platform The Broke Backpacker. Will shares his journey from backpacking around the world for two years to launching about 20 businesses becoming an authority in travel, digital marketing, and entrepreneurship. Will talks about being authentic, transparent, and relatable to his audience, balancing work and personal life, and taking time off to reflect and recharge. He also discusses his strategies for online success, such as negotiating with affiliates, staying organized and trusting his team, scaling content, and niching down to set himself apart. Will also shares his future plans, including opening a second tribal hostel in Lombok and working on his next book and possible podcast. Despite facing setbacks from the COVID-19 pandemic, Will illustrates that personal growth, resilience, and adaptability are key to entrepreneurial success in a changing digital landscape.
